Mo Gaffney
Mo Gaffney (born Maureen E. Gaffney on November 8, 1958 in San Diego, California) is an American actress, comedienne, writer and human rights activist. 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~

~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 She hosted two of her own television talk shows: Women Aloud! (which was shown on the Comedy Central network) and The Mo Show. She and friend Kathy Najimy wrote and starred in two off-Broadway shows, both called The Kathy and Mo Show, both of which won Obie awards. She has also appeared in a few episodes of That 70's Show. 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 Gaffney went on to team up with Jennifer Saunders with a recurring role as Bo in the sitcom Absolutely Fabulous; as of 2004 a spin-off show is in pre-production. 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~
